Author

Quarles, Francis

Title

Solomons recantation, entituled Ecclesiastes, paraphrased. : With a soliloquie or meditation upon every chapter. Very seasonable and usefull for these times. / By Francis Quarles. With a short relation of his life and death..

Varying form of title

Solomons recantation, entitvled Ecclesiastes, paraphrased

Edition

The third edition..

Imprint

London. : Printed for Richard Royston, and are to be sold at his shop at the signe of the Angel in Ivy-Lane., 1648..

Physical description

[8], 62, [2] p. : port. ; 4⁰.

Note

Signatures: A-I⁴.

Note

In verse.

Note

With a frontispiece portrait of the author (A1v), signed: W.M. sculp:, i.e. William Marshall.

Note

Includes "A short relation of the life and death of Mr. Francis Quarles, by Ursula Quarles, his sorrowfull widow.".

Citation/references note

Wing (CD-Rom, 1996), Q117

Citation/references note

ESTC, R6110

Citation/references note

Horden, J. Quarles, XXV, 3

Reproduction note

Microfilm. Ann Arbor, Mich. University Microfilms, 1977. 1 microfilm reel. 35 mm. (Early English books, 1641-1700; 773:22).

Provenance

Part of the Gillingham Parochial Library, bequeathed to the vicar and feoffees of the parish lands of Gillingham, Dorset by Thomas Freke (d. 1718?), and placed on permanent loan in Salisbury Cathedral Library 25 November 1992. "SS.2" and "165" inscribed on upper flyleaf. Spine label with "178". Gillingham reference SS2/-/178.

Provenance

Salisbury Cathedral Library bookplate (20th century) with design based on the Dean and Chapter seal, and inscription “Sarvm Cathedral Library.”

Binding

17th-century sprinkled brown calf over rope-fibre boards; sewn on three tanned leather thongs; blind fillets forming rectangular frame toward board edges, with additional vertical blind fillet towards spine edge; blind fillets on spine; paper spine label with title; blind fillet around board edges; text block edges sprinkled red.

Copy-specific note

Imperfect: lacking portrait.
